webAppRootKey的目的是什么?

nov*_*ice 26 web.xml servlets spring-mvc

有人可以在web.xml中解释这个条目吗?什么时候必须使用?为什么?

<context-param>
    <param-name>webAppRootKey</param-name>
    <param-value>webapp.root</param-value>
</context-param>
Run Code Online (Sandbox Code Playgroud)

这是与Spring相关的还是普通的?

小智 22

这是一般的和春季特定的.context-param允许您指定上下文参数(这是常规的),但您指定的内容特定于您的应用程序,您的应用程序将查找参数并使用它.

在这种情况下,它是系统属性的键,应指定此Web应用程序的根目录.由WebAppRootListenerLog4jConfigListener应用.


Jua*_*ero 5

我有同样的问题,并在 Spring 中找到了这个页面和后来的WebApproot。最好在mblinn's answer 中进行解释。